

Overview
In order to find out who's behind a cattle rustling operation that's hurting ranchers, a detective for the Cattleman's Protective Association pretends to be a tenderfoot from back east who's just arrived in the area and doesn't know how to ride, rope or shoot.
Year 1917
Studio Douglas Fairbanks Pictures
Director Joseph Henabery
Crew Joseph Henabery (Director), Douglas Fairbanks (Scenario Writer), Victor Fleming (Director of Photography), John Fairbanks (General Manager), Jackson Gregory (Story)
